Output 796a135a625e0d6f9e757a87c459505112aa856489093ed92a21e5317424686f:29

value
24424481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35f1ba2b6c97ad02e265b157f89f473bbd5e5805 OP_EQUAL
address
MCpPd6i7af1He5267u2MM2nioLh6aXMuEa
transaction
796a135a625e0d6f9e757a87c459505112aa856489093ed92a21e5317424686f
spent
true